During Pregnancy
1: Figure out any complications during your mothers pregnancies. Knowing this information can give you an idea of complications you may have during you pregnancy. Remember, it is not absolutely certain that you will have complications if your mom had them, however it is still recommended to know this information.
2: Make extra time for doctor visits. This one is pretty obvious but should not be overseen. Regular doctor visits are an important factor in all pregnancies and twin pregnancies are no exception. Make sure to make appointments every 2-4 weeks.
4: Report anything unusual. If you notice anything out of the ordinary such as cramming or discharge notify your doctor. Keep in mind that mothers of twin pregnancies tend to get cramps earlier in the pregnancy, still this should not stop you from contacting your doctor if anything usual happens. Its better to be safe than sorry.
3: Listen to what your body is telling you. As the pregnancy advances you may experience changes in mood and energy. Make sure to rest when you are feeling tired. Don't overwork or try to finish everything in one day. Try to not stress out. Remember to make time to take care of yourself and dont forget to pamper yourself because you deserve it
5: Have healthy diet. This is not an excuse to eat more than usual!! (unfortunately). Many people think that twin moms should eat twice the normal amount but that is not the case. Here is a list of what you should eat:
-
Fruits and veggies (carrots, broccoli, spinach, beets)
-
Enriched whole grains (breads and cereals)
-
Milk products (for healthy bones)
-
Lean meats (skinless chicken, fish)
-
Water!!
Also try to eat as much organic foods as possible. Avoid processed foods and junk foods (chips, pastries, fried foods, everything that's good). Remember that this is not forever and in the end you'll be glad that you did it! ​
